首页 > 文章列表 > API接口 > 正文

免费短信API接口及IP查询API大全教程分享

如何借助免费短信API接口及IP查询API实现精准用户沟通与安全防护

在互联网飞速发展的当下,企业和开发者越来越依赖API接口来提升业务效率和用户体验。免费短信API接口与IP查询API成为了许多项目不可或缺的工具,然而,如何将这两大技术资源整合利用,解决实际业务痛点,却依然是摆在众多开发者和运营人员面前的一大难题。本文着眼于“借助免费短信API接口及IP查询API实现精准用户沟通与安全防护”的具体实践,深入分析痛点、给出详尽解决方案,并用实际操作步骤揭示技术应用的核心,力图为您带来切实可行的思路和方法。

一、痛点分析:用户沟通难与安全风险双重挑战

在移动互联网时代,企业与用户的沟通渠道极为丰富,短信作为一种直接且高效的沟通方式,依然具有不可替代的优势。
然而,现实中许多企业面临以下几大难题:

  • 短信发送成本高昂:商用短信接口费用普遍较高,令中小企业和初创项目望而却步。
  • 用户精准定位难:想要基于用户IP地址实现地理位置大致判断,以定向推送内容或防范异常登录行为,却缺乏便捷高效的IP查询工具。
  • 安全性隐患大:频繁短信验证在减少欺诈行为中作用显著,但因未结合IP异常检测,难以及时阻断恶意攻击。

综上,如何在保证零成本或低成本使用资源的基础上,精准识别用户身份、提升安全保障与沟通效率,打造“既经济又智能”的系统,成为亟需解决的核心问题。

二、解决方案:整合免费短信API与IP查询API构建智能通信与安全体系

针对上述痛点,一个可行的解决方向是:

  1. 免费短信API接口:利用市面上优质的免费短信接口实现短信验证码发送、提醒通知、营销推送等多样化场景,切实降低短信运营成本;
  2. IP查询API:通过访问免费高质量IP查询接口,实时获取用户IP地理位置信息,辅助检测异常访问,实现基于“地理+短信”的二次身份验证,提升账户安全;
  3. 智能判别机制:结合短信验证结果与IP地址异常监测,精确判断用户身份和行为风险,自动触发预警或二次核验;
  4. 灵活组合应用:根据业务需求灵活设计短信发送时机与IP检测逻辑,构建符合自身用户画像的专属通信安全方案。

通过上述方案,既能保证短信发送的高效经济,又能实现多维度的安全风控,推动业务稳定健康发展。

三、步骤详解:实操指南助你快速搭建系统

接下来,围绕整合免费短信API和IP查询API的核心流程,详细拆解实施步骤,助你一步步完成落地。

1. 选择合适的免费短信API接口

目前网络上有多家提供短信接口服务的厂商支持免费套餐,推荐优先考虑接口稳定、文档详细、用户评价良好的平台,例如“百度云短信”、“阿里云短信基础版”等免费额度计划。
注意确认以下点:

  • 是否支持RESTful API调用;
  • 提供的短信模版是否灵活;
  • 免费额度及超额费用;
  • 接口调用的速率限制;
  • 响应时间与错误码说明。

获取账号与API Key后,先在测试环境验证接口调用成功,再进入正式开发。

2. 集成免费短信API完成验证码发送模块

短信验证是最直接的用户身份确认方式,流程大致如下:

  1. 用户输入手机号,点击“发送验证码”按钮;
  2. 系统调用短信API接口,向对应手机号发送自动生成的随机短信验证码;
  3. 用户接收验证码后,输入界面提交系统端验证;
  4. 系统核验验证码有效性(包括是否过期、输入是否正确),确认后允许后续操作。

在此过程中需注意:

  • 验证码长度一般为4~6位数字,避免复杂;
  • 验证码有效期建议控制在5分钟以内;
  • 限制短时间内重复发送,防止骚扰及资源浪费;
  • 记录发送日志,便于后续分析。

3. 选取高质量IP查询API接口实现地理信息获取

IP查询接口能将访问者IP转换为地理位置信息,包括国家、省份、城市甚至运营商信息。推荐使用的免费IP查询API示例有“淘宝IP地址库API”、“ip-api.com”、“ipgeolocation.io”等。
同样,在接入过程中重点关注:

  • API请求频率限制及日调用量;
  • 返回数据字段的准确性和丰富度;
  • 接口响应速度及稳定性。

实现流程示范:

1. 获取访问者IP地址(从请求头或服务器日志);
2. 调用IP查询API接口,如https://ip-api.com/json/118.114.62.60;
3. 解析返回的JSON数据,提取省份、城市等字段;
4. 根据地理信息定制后续业务逻辑。

4. 设计集成逻辑实现智能身份判别与安全风控

将短信验证与IP查询数据相结合,可以构建多层次身份安全机制。例如:

  • 正常用户在常用地区登录时,只需短信验证码核验;
  • 如检测到异地登录或异常IP段,则提升安全等级,触发额外验证流程,如图片验证码、人脸识别等;
  • 将IP黑名单库结合短信发送频率,避免被恶意机器频繁利用发送短信骚扰。

实际编码中,可以通过建立中间件或服务层完成逻辑判别,自动化决策流程,提升用户体验的同时大幅度降低安全风险。

5. 持续监控与优化,确保系统稳定高效

系统搭建完成后,切不可掉以轻心,需:

  • 定期检查短信发送成功率与IP查询准确度;
  • 监控接口调用次数,避免超出免费额度导致服务中断;
  • 根据用户反馈和数据统计不断调整验证码发送频率、IP异常阈值;
  • 安全事件发生时及时定位问题,优化防护策略。

借助日志分析与自动化脚本实现持续调优,是保障长期运营的关键所在。

四、效果预期:成效显著,助力业务持续健康发展

落实以上方案后,您将收获以下效益:

  • 成 本 大 幅 降 低:利用免费API,短信成本减至最低,提高中小企业竞争力,助力新业务快速起步;
  • 用 户 体 验 优 化:短信验证流程顺畅,地理定位适时辅助,减少误判和操作繁复,降低用户流失风险;
  • 安 全 等 级 提 升:异地登录识别与短信联动核验等多维度防护策略,明显减少账号被盗与欺诈事件发生频率;
  • 运 维 成 本 降 低:自动化监控和日志分析机制,轻松应对运营中出现的各类异常,保障系统稳定性;
  • 数 据 决 策 支 持:积累IP与短信数据,为后续精准营销和用户画像、业务拓展提供丰富数据支撑。

总的来说,合理并巧妙地整合免费短信API与IP查询API,不仅帮助企业解决了短信成本与安全防护的双重难题,更实现了用户体验与业务效益的跃升,成为数字化转型中不可或缺的利器。

五、结语

技术的力量源于落地和创新。免费短信API和IP查询API看似简单,却能通过合理的组合和应用,为企业打造高效、安全、智能的通信服务体系。希望本文能够为您破解困扰已久的难题,激发更多关于API深度融合的探索思路。未来,随着API生态的日益丰富与完善,应用边界将不断扩展,我们也期待您能在这条路上持续前行,创造更多可能。

— End —

分享文章

微博
QQ
QQ空间
复制链接
操作成功
顶部
底部